Output 129c4a5e387d7b0d15c834dbc854da6fb2f8d9ae419e45c687ff052280b6cc8b:0

value
635081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a654b9d600e2b5891b5cf5ec8a4af8ae50c5cce OP_EQUAL
address
32dz2b3UbgFzuGfiQRsDELGrWYEcLfdYRe
transaction
129c4a5e387d7b0d15c834dbc854da6fb2f8d9ae419e45c687ff052280b6cc8b
confirmations
302700
spent
true